Portfolio

Data

agosto 2021 - Incompleto

Logo Portfolio
  • Pesquisa e Planejamento

    O desafio do Bootcamp era criar um Portfolio com o intutio de dispor outros projetos. A principio eu realizei uma pesquisa para referências de layout, cores e fontes. Em seguida fiz um rascunho no Figma, para então começar a desenvolver o projeto.

    • Sistema de design
    • Dribbble
    • Awwwards
    • Airbnb design
    • Behance
    • UX Design
    • Google Fonts
  • Tecnologias e Linguagens

    Durante o Bootcamp, pude conhecer o Next.js, React e Style-components. Expandi meu conhecimento em CSS e pude desenvolver animações e efeitos. Além disso passei a utilizar pacotes para garantir fluxos de integração contínua e deploy contínuo (CI/CD) no projeto.

    • JS, ES6
    • HTML
    • CSS
    • Styled-components
    • Next.js
    • React
    • Conventional Commits
    • ESLint
    • Husky
  • Testes e validações

    Os testes servem para garantir a qualidade das funcionalidades do site. O Cypress foi utilizado para testar o ContactForm e o yup para validar os inputs do formulário. O React Testing Library foi utilizado nos componentes e Jest para o código JS mais simples. Também adicionei o mecanismo de testes ao padrão de qualidade do ESLint.

    • Cypress
    • Jest
    • Yup
    • React Testing Library
  • Fontes e cores

    A fonte escolhida para o projeto foi Sora, disponibilizada pelo GoogleFonts. Foram escolhidas cores neutras e para alguns detalhes da pagina, a cor #96A7CF.

    Fonte Sora

    O portfolio começou sendo o primeiro desafio do Bootcamp Front End Avançado da Alura, mas com o passar das etapas decidi me aprofundar e melhorar cada vez mais o projeto. Com isso, conheci e aprendi novas ferramentas, desenvolvi novos projetos e adquiri novos conhecimentos.